Analysis of the spirits sector in Finland shows a steady decline in employment from 2024 to 2028. In 2024, the employment stood at 565.08 FTEs and is forecasted to decrease to 528.55 FTEs by 2028. The year-on-year percentage variation indicates a consistent downward trend, with employment dropping by approximately 1.67% annually between 2024 and 2025, 1.66% between 2025 and 2026, 1.65% between 2026 and 2027, and 1.65% from 2027 to 2028.
